Full solution
GETTING COZYStraightforward
CUDDLING,HUGGING,SNUGGLING,SPOONING

CUDDLING, HUGGING, SNUGGLING, and SPOONING all describe forms of close, affectionate physical embrace

GOSSIPINGModerate
BUZZING,DISHING,SPILLING,WHISPERING

BUZZING, DISHING, SPILLING, and WHISPERING are all ways of describing the act of gossiping or sharing confidential information

ENGAGING IN AN ACTIVITY WITH PINS OR NEEDLESTricky
ACUPUNCTURING,BOWLING,SEWING,WRESTLING

ACUPUNCTURING uses needles, BOWLING uses pins, SEWING uses needles, and WRESTLING involves pinning — all activities involving pins or needles

STARTING WITH TITLESDevious
DOCTORING,LORDING,MISSING,SIRING

DOCTORING starts with DR, LORDING starts with LORD, MISSING starts with MISS, and SIRING starts with SIR — each word begins with a title
